Champion HTF Featherweight is an elegant sans-serif font designed by Hoefler Type Foundry, first released in 1990 as part of the Champion Gothic family. Known for its ultra-lightweight, it brings a sleek and refined look to any design project.
Its design is inspired by the condensed and compact Gothic letterforms used in 19th-century American wood type. Champion HTF Featherweight belongs to the larger Champion Gothic family.

Where Should I Use This Font
Champion HTF Featherweight’s minimalistic and sleek style makes it ideal for projects where sophistication and clarity are key. However, due to its light strokes, it’s best used in larger sizes or in print where readability remains intact.
